Under the program manager, the project manager is responsible for the outcome of the assigned projects. The project manager leads the team through the Commonwealth Standard for Project Management for successful completion of the project phases: PreSelect, Initiation, Planning, Execution and Control, and Closeout.
The selected candidate will:
* Serve as a hands-on technical project manager with development staff and business groups.
* Coordinate and communicate with ITD management and staff to organize work tasks and resourcing.
* Communicate timelines and expectations to technical and business staff.
* Collaborate with vendors, consultants, and contractors in the execution of projects, including contract management and working with the procurement office(s).
* Collaborate with technology leads and solution architects to incorporate agency best practices into project plans.
* Adhere to VDOT and VITA project management practices and governance requirements; coordinate with VDOT and VITA Project Management Offices.
* Maintain project budget, plans, tasks, schedules, risks, and status, and disseminate information to team members and customers as defined in the communications plan.
* Monitor progress by third-party vendors and define and measure their progress with metrics.
* Ensure documentation of requirements and use cases; facilitate design workshops for assigned projects.
* Ensure definition of test objectives, design test plans and test cases for assigned projects.
* Provide the management of project milestones and deliverables for on-time and on-budget delivery.
* Define, measure, and clearly communicate progress with metrics.
* Support system and application training efforts.
